Ciri's Combat Style in The Witcher 4: A Breakdown

In *The Witcher 4*, fans are eagerly anticipating a significant shift as Ciri steps into the spotlight, taking over as the protagonist from the iconic Geralt. This transition has ignited discussions about how it might influence the game's mechanics, especially combat. Recently, CD Projekt RED provided some insights during their podcast, offering a glimpse into what players can expect.
The developers highlighted a scene from the game's trailer where Ciri battles a monster using a chain—a homage to *The Witcher 1*. What distinguishes her approach is her fluid, acrobatic combat style. They described the difference between Ciri’s and Geralt’s combat approaches:
There was this one scene where we see the chain, which is a tribute to *The Witcher 1*. When she grabs the monster’s head with it and pins it to the ground, she also performs an additional flip, which was really cool because you can’t imagine Geralt doing something like that.
He’s very... I’d say he’s agile, but he’s also very... he feels almost like a ‘block’ in a way—he’s bulky and heavy. And she [Ciri] is just... she’s practically like liquid compared to [Geralt].
This comparison underscores the stark contrast between the two characters. While Geralt's combat style is rooted in strength and precision, Ciri's movements are characterized by speed, dynamism, and agility. Her ability to execute acrobatic maneuvers introduces a new level of excitement to the gameplay, setting her apart from the more grounded and stoic Geralt.
With Ciri leading the charge in *The Witcher 4*, players can anticipate a more fluid and fast-paced combat experience that mirrors her unique personality and abilities.
